Francona was traded twice for Larry Doby. Wow

12/03/1957 - he, Ray Moore and Billy Goodman were dealt to the Chicago White Sox for Larry Doby, Jack Harshman and Jim Marshall.

 On March 21, 1959, he was traded to the Cleveland Indians for Larry Doby, the second trade involving the two.

March 12, 2018 at 2:35 PM ET

Mejia, Almonte optioned by Tribe

The Indians made a second round of cuts Monday, optioning catcher Francisco Mejia -- the club's No. 1 prospect as ranked by MLB Pipeline -- to Triple-A Columbus, alongside outfielder Abraham Almonte and pitchers Julian Merryweather, Shawn Morimando and Adam Plutko.

There is no age limit on kids run the bases that I'm aware of.  In fact, you probably could too (I have when my son was younger).  Obviously it's not 1 at a time or it would take forever, it's kind of single file.  So while it's cool, your son will need to dodge the little dudes the entire time, but that's not a big deal.  People start lining up towards the end of the game in the right field concourse back where the ramps are.  When the line begins to move after the game you end up going below the stadium before hitting the field.  Never know what/who you might see, so keep the autograph stuff handy if that's his thing.  Before the game, both outfield lines are pretty accessible for autographs.  Nobody will/should care what you guys are wearing.
